Million Dollar Password is an updated version of the game show Password on CBS, which was hosted by Regis Philbin and ran from June 1, 2008, to June 14, 2009. FremantleMedia produced the program
Endless Games began distributing a home box version of Million Dollar Password in November 200827 and a second edition was released in June 2010.28 iToys distributed a handheld electronic version of the program in 2008

A secret combination of characters, including letters, numbers, and/or symbols, used to authenticate a user's identity and grant access to a system, account, or resource. Passwords are typically private and should be kept secure to prevent unauthorized access.
To access her email account, Sarah entered her password, which consisted of a mix of uppercase letters, numbers, and special characters.
